Pricing Breakdown of Round Table Pizza Menu Items
Round Table Pizza offers a variety of menu items, each priced according to size, toppings, and specialty. Understanding the pricing structure can help customers make informed choices that suit their budget and preferences.
The primary pricing categories are:
- Pizzas: Prices vary by size (small, medium, large, and extra-large) and type (classic, premium, or specialty).
- Toppings: Additional toppings usually cost extra, priced per topping per pizza.
- Sides and Appetizers: These include items such as garlic sticks, wings, and salads, typically priced individually.
- Beverages: Soft drinks and other beverages are priced per serving size.
- Desserts: Sweet options like cookies or brownies carry separate pricing.
Below is a general price guide based on typical Round Table Pizza offerings. Note that prices may vary by location and promotions:
Menu Item | Size | Price Range (USD) | Notes |
---|---|---|---|
Classic Round Table Pizza | Small (10″) | $8.99 – $12.99 | Basic cheese or pepperoni options |
Classic Round Table Pizza | Medium (12″) | $12.99 – $16.99 | Includes choice of standard toppings |
Classic Round Table Pizza | Large (14″) | $16.99 – $21.99 | Popular size for groups |
Specialty Pizzas | Medium (12″) | $15.99 – $19.99 | Includes premium ingredients |
Specialty Pizzas | Large (14″) | $19.99 – $24.99 | Examples: King Arthur’s Supreme, Veggie Royale |
Additional Toppings | Per topping | $1.50 – $2.00 | Varies by type of topping |
Appetizers & Sides | Individual | $4.50 – $8.00 | Includes wings, garlic sticks, salads |
Beverages | Regular (20 oz) | $1.99 – $2.50 | Soft drinks and iced tea |
Desserts | Individual | $3.00 – $5.00 | Cookies, brownies, and other sweets |

Typical Franchise Investment Costs
For those interested in owning a Round Table Pizza franchise, understanding the investment costs is essential. These costs include initial franchise fees, equipment, real estate, and operational expenses.
Cost Category | Estimated Amount (USD) | Details |
---|---|---|
Initial Franchise Fee | $35,000 – $45,000 | Paid to Round Table Pizza for the franchise rights |
Startup Costs | $350,000 – $700,000 | Includes equipment, leasehold improvements, signage |
Working Capital | $50,000 – $100,000 | Funds needed to cover initial operating expenses |
Royalty Fees | 5% – 6% of gross sales | Ongoing monthly fees to the franchisor |
Advertising Fees | 3% – 4% of gross sales | Contributions to marketing and brand promotion |

Pricing Overview of Round Table Pizza
Round Table Pizza offers a variety of pizzas and menu items with prices that vary depending on size, toppings, and location. Understanding the pricing structure can help customers make informed choices whether ordering for individual meals or group events.
Pizza Sizes and Price Ranges
Round Table Pizza typically offers three standard sizes:
Size | Diameter | Price Range (USD) |
---|---|---|
Individual | 8 inches | $6.00 – $9.00 |
Medium | 12 inches | $12.00 – $16.00 |
Large | 14 inches | $16.00 – $22.00 |
Prices vary based on specialty pizzas, crust type, and additional toppings.
Specialty Pizzas and Toppings
Round Table Pizza is known for its specialty pizzas, which often include premium ingredients and unique flavor profiles. These pizzas tend to be at the higher end of the price spectrum.
- Specialty pizzas such as the King Arthur’s Supreme or the Mt. Diablo Meat Lovers generally cost between $15 and $22 for medium to large sizes.
- Customers can customize pizzas with a variety of toppings including pepperoni, sausage, mushrooms, olives, and more.
- Each additional topping typically adds $1.50 to $2.00 depending on size.
Additional Menu Items and Pricing
Beyond pizza, Round Table offers several complementary items priced as follows:
- Appetizers: Garlic cheese bread, wings, and salads typically range from $5 to $10.
- Beverages: Soft drinks and bottled beverages usually cost between $2 and $4.
- Desserts: Items like brownies or cinnamon sticks are priced around $4 to $6.
